This is a brilliantly splendent galena crystal with superb luster along with a rich metallic gray color. It is complete on the display sides, cleaved only in the back where it contacted matrix. Most of these are massive and poorly dimensional, whereas this crystal really leaps out! This old time specimen is accompanied by a label denoting the Ralph E. Merrill collection and dated July 1, 1954. These are a thing of the past, and seldom seen for sale today. The fancy, sleek look of the crystals and the complex modifications make them really stand out.
